## GraphTrellis Account Recovery

If you lose access to your GraphTrellis admin account, do not attempt repeated logins; three failures lock the visualizer's dependency-index service for an hour. Instead, open the recovery console from a trusted workstation, confirm your contractor badge status with the Meridex team lead, and select "offline restore." When prompted, enter the passphrase exactly as shown below.

unlock words, fafop-hawep: briwyn-oliix-sorox

### Runbook: Account Recovery During DNS Flakiness

When Greywick's internal resolver intermittently fails, the Wardenloop account-recovery flow can stall at the identity-verification step because upstream lookups time out. First confirm the failure is resolver-side by querying the secondary resolver directly; do not bypass verification checks. If both resolvers fail, operators may switch Wardenloop to the static host map, an action that requires unsealing the emergency config with the recovery passphrase below.

recovery phrase for fawif-tajeg: norael-aldmir-casir-brivan-ulaion

## Authentication

The Spoolrider autoscaler polls queue depth on the Ferrow message broker every 15 seconds and adjusts worker counts accordingly. All calls to the broker's metrics endpoint require an API key scoped to read-only metrics access. Support team members troubleshooting scaling stalls should first confirm the key has not been rotated without a config update, since an auth failure causes the autoscaler to freeze at the last known worker count. The current key for the metrics endpoint follows.

service key, bajog-yahop: kto7_mMHVCpJ

## Who to ping about GiftNote

Welcome aboard! GiftNote is our donation-receipt mailer for the Larchfield Fund. Template tweaks go to the comms folks; delivery failures and bounce weirdness go to the platform crew. Don't push template changes on Fridays — receipts batch over the weekend. For anything GiftNote-related, start with the address below.

billing contact of kaweg-tajeg = drudor.lamion.oliath@torvalabs.test